Wilmore While Wilmore has several churches within its city limits, almost all were established prior to the existence of Wilmore and were located in rural areas The first church building erected in Wilmore was the Presbyterian Church in 1884, which still meets in the same location and structure
Wilmore I welcome you to Wilmore, home to nearly 6,000 citizens It was founded as a railroad town in 1876 with the building of the nearby historic High Bridge Railroad Bridge that spans the Kentucky River Gorge and its palisades
